The Four QuartersPart 101.01 This section considers the physical world in which we live and its spiritual correspondences. 01.02 Many books on practical kabbalistic magic start with a consideration of the four compass points, or four quarters. A common exercise is The Lesser Ritual of the Pentagram. However, the attributions usually found in this ritual are in fact not those of classical kabbalah. It is reasonable to assume that what we are presented with today is a corruption of the kabbalistic original. 01.03 An appreciation of the four quarters is important as they define the physical space in which we exist. By looking at their spiritual counterparts we can begin to recognise and reinforce the links which exist between the physical and the spiritual worlds. 01.04 The four quarters are North, South, East and West. Each of these quarters has associated with it (amongst other things) one of the four classical elements and an archangel. 01.05 The kabbalistic attributes are:
01.06 These attributes are contained in a common Jewish prayer and are also referred to in such fundamental texts as The Zohar and The Bahir. 01.07 As these attributes become part of our everyday life we begin to recognise that we exist in a kabbalistic universe. |
